    FERDINAND BLAMES UNITED STAR AFTER OLD TRAFFORD LOSS – AMORIM WARNED OF TROPHYLESS SEASON

     

    BREAKING NEWS: Just one game into the new Premier League campaign, and Manchester United are already in turmoil.

     

    A narrow 1-0 defeat to Arsenal at Old Trafford has sparked outrage among supporters — and club legend Rio Ferdinand has delivered a brutal verdict.

     

    His warning? If things don’t change fast, Ruben Amorim could be staring at another trophyless season.

     

    Speaking after the match, Ferdinand made his feelings clear:

     

    “I can sense Amorim’s dismissal coming. How can a manager with a winning mentality continue to back a player like this? United will end up empty-handed again if nothing changes.”

     

    The player in question? Manuel Ugarte.

     

    The Uruguayan midfielder, brought in to add steel to United’s engine room, was singled out after a poor display.

     

    Against Arsenal, Ugarte repeatedly lost possession, failed to shield the defense, and looked overwhelmed in midfield.

     

    For Ferdinand, those shortcomings are unacceptable at a club that aspires to challenge for silverware.

     

    “This isn’t PSG or Sporting anymore,” Ferdinand said bluntly. “The Premier League is ruthless.

     

    If you’re the one anchoring United’s midfield, you can’t be anonymous at Old Trafford. Ugarte looks out of his depth, and Amorim risks paying the price if he continues to rely on him.”

     

    The remarks split opinion among fans. Some echoed Ferdinand’s view, branding Ugarte a “panic signing” unfit for United’s level.

     

    Others argued the midfielder deserves patience to adapt, pointing instead to Amorim’s tactical setup as the real issue.

     

    But Ferdinand insists patience is a luxury United cannot afford. With rivals like Manchester City, Liverpool, and Arsenal already firing, he believes Amorim must act decisively. “You don’t win trophies carrying players who can’t deliver. If Ugarte slows United down, Amorim has to be ruthless.”

     

    The opening-day defeat has already placed Amorim under pressure, leaving fans wondering if he’ll back his under-fire midfielder or make a bold call to silence the growing criticism.

     

    For Ferdinand, though, the conclusion is simple: stick with Ugarte, and United’s season could unravel before it even begins.
